For our 145th episode we bring you a special BONUS Duet Review revisiting Dinner is Served, an immersive dance-theatre experience, choreographed and directed by Kristen Carcone (with Ross Wirtanen and Clinton Edward), presented by Toes for Dance. Join Jillian Robinson and Ryan Borochovitz, as they follow up their original review with a more granular deep dive into their unique journeys through this site-specific production!
The run of Dinner is Served ended on July 2nd, 2023. To learn more about the production, see Toes for Dance’s website (https://www.toesfordance.ca/dinner-is-served ) and tune in to our original review: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=DPrSeGEI-P4
